You can read this website in your language — CLICK THE BELOW "TRANSLATE" BUTTON!You can read this website in your language — CLICK THE BELOW "TRANSLATE" BUTTON!
Tech news - Page 2 of 2 - ViralVista91 – Latest Jobs, Trending News & Career Guides -
Skip to content